ovTrapAgentSysNameThe System Group name or best name of the agent
that generated the trap. DisplayString .1 |
ovTrapSeverityAlarm severity information delivered with the trap.
Values are critical, major, minor, warning and
informational. OvTrapSeverity .2 |
ovTrapStatusStatus of the problem being reported. Values are
discovered and resolved. OvTrapStatus .3 |
ovTrapDescriptionThe alarm description. Probably the same string
as what is shown in the problem log. DisplayString .4 |
ovTrapOffenderNameThe best name (MAC, IP, DNS or SNMP) of the host
that the alarm message is associated to. DisplayString .5 |
ovTrapOffenderNetAddrThe network address (IP, IPX, NETBIOS DOMAIN) of
the host that the alarm message is associated to. DisplayString .6 |
ovTrapOffenderPhyAddrThe MAC address of the host that the alarm message
is associated to. DisplayString .7 |
ovTrapOffenderSubIdA secondary key to identify the problem instance.
This is used when more than one problem of the
SAME type can occur on the SAME offender.
For example, some problems occur on a particular
interface of an offender host. In this case, an
NMS station can use the offender information along with
this SubId to track the problem.
The identifier is arbitrary and managed by the agent. INTEGER .8 |
